Hello!

I'm new here, and this is my first post.

My primary reader is a Kindle Paperwhite Signature edition, which I use to read prose novels, pulp magazines, and most manga.

My secondary reader is a Samsung Galaxy Tab S8+, which I use for American comics through the Marvel and DC apps and CDisplay.

I did get a Kindle Scribe, but returned it. The reading experience was less pleasant for novels than my Paperwhite, and less pleasant for comics than my tablet, so I found myself not using it after a few days. I returned it for Amazon credit and now have enough credit to pay for all my books for the rest of the year, at least.

I'm off for the summer, so I've been reading a lot. My favorite books this summer have been The Only One Left by Riley Sager, The Last Word by Taylor Adams, and A Kiss Before Dying by Ira Levin. My most disappointing book this summer has been Eileen, by Otessa Moshfegh. Given how highly praised Eileen is, I can only assume that it's just not for me, that I'm not seeing something that, say, the Booker Prize people did.

I've had one DNF this summer - Death Watch, which is about an advertising agency hired to promote a watch that can kill the person wearing it. It wasn't terrible, I just didn't care about any of the characters and if I'm not hooked after roughly the first 100 pages, I'm out. At 100 pages, the ad agency had just begun discussing how they were going to advertise the watch.

I'm currently halfway through Last House on Needless Street by Catriona Ward. It's been OK. I'm reserving judgment until I finish.
